Explain Morrison's purpose for including the flashback scene between Baby Suggs and Stamp Paid in this chapter.

English
1 answer:
RideAnS [48]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

The purpose of including the flashback between Baby Suggs and Stamp Paid in this chapter is to indicate the gradual withdrawal of Sethe after she killed her child.

Explanation:

"Beloved" is a novel written by Toni Morrison. The novel is about Sethe, a former slave, who kills her daughter to protect her from going again into slavery. The story is based on true story of Margaret Garner.

In the novel, after Stamp Paid, pays visit to 124, he recalls a scene between Baby Suggs and him, where he encourages Baby Suggs to not give up on her gatherings. After Sethe has killed her child, Baby Suggs began to withdraw from her gatherings and Sethe also withdrew herself from neighbours. This flashback informs the readers the pain of not only of Sethe but of all slaves.

How does lyddie react to being fired?why?

Lyddie is so taken aback by the interview when Mr. Marsden brings her before the company agent that she is speechless. Mr. Marsden accuses her of "moral turpitude," and she does not know what "turpitude" means. She is too embarrassed, of course, to ask them. she feels resentful of the injustice when she is fired, but she knows that there is nothing she can do about it. Mr. Marsden targeted Lyddie because she saw him harassing Brigid and stopped him. Lyddie understands that Mr. Marsden lied about her to get her fired.
